Monster Cookie Bars

Monster Cookie Bars That Make Every Bite a Sweet Adventure

Indulge in delightful Monster Cookie Bars filled with chocolate, peanut butter, and oats for a nostalgic treat that everyone will love.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 25 minutes
Cooling Time 15 minutes
Total Time 50 minutes
Servings: 12 bars
Course: Dessert
Cuisine: American
Calories: 250

Ingredients
  

For the Base
  • 1 cup Salted Butter Use unsalted if you're watching sodium.
  • 1 cup Peanut Butter Substitute almond butter for a nut-free option.
  • 1 cup Brown Sugar Consider coconut sugar for a lower glycemic index.
  • 1/2 cup Granulated Sugar Can swap with honey or maple syrup as a liquid alternative.
  • 2 large Eggs Use flax eggs for a vegan substitute.
  • 2 teaspoons Vanilla Extract Opt for pure vanilla for the best results.
  • 2 cups All-Purpose Flour Replace with gluten-free flour for a gluten-free version.
  • 3 cups Rolled Oats Quick oats create a smoother texture.
For the Leavening
  • 1 teaspoon Baking Soda Avoid substitution without careful measurement.
  • 1 teaspoon Baking Powder Ensure it's fresh for optimal results.
  • 1/2 teaspoon Salt Can omit if using salted butter.
For the Mix-ins
  • 1 cup Semi-Sweet Chocolate Chips Dark chocolate chips offer a richer taste.
  • 1 cup M&M’s Swap with chocolate chunks or different nuts for a fun twist.

Equipment

  • Oven
  • 9x9-inch baking pan
  • Mixing Bowl
  • Spatula
  • hand mixer

Method
 

Preparation
  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(180°C) and line a 9x9-inch baking pan with parchment paper.
  2. In a large bowl, cream together the salted butter, peanut but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ar until smooth and fluffy.
  3. Add the eggs and vanilla extract, beating until well incorporated.
  4. Gradually mix in the all-purpose flour, rolled oats, baking soda, baking powder, and salt until a thick dough forms.
  5. Fold in the semi-sweet chocolate chips and M&M’s until evenly distributed.
  6. Pour the dough into the prepared baking pan and spread it evenly.
  7.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es until golden brown and a toothpick comes out clean.
  8. Remove from the oven and let cool completely on a wire rack before slicing into squares.

Notes

Keep a close eye on baking time to avoid overbaking. Allowing bars to cool before slicing helps maintain structure.
